Building Bridges, Brick by Brick: A Guide to Local Networking

Successful networking isn't regarding cold calls and empty promises. It's about forging genuine connections that support your journey. Local networking, in particular, can be a valuable tool for achieving your goals.

Start by identifying the groups relevant to your interests or profession. Attend events and don't be afraid to initiate yourself to others. Remember, networking is a two-way street – be authentic in your interactions and focus on building significant relationships.

One valuable strategy is to volunteer your time or expertise to local organizations. This not only contributes your community but also provides opportunities to network with like-minded individuals.

Remember, building bridges takes time and effort. Be patient, persistent, and always focus on creating worth for those you meet with.
